SUBJECT: Contingency Relief Funds (Council District 4)
Contingency Relief funds from Council District 4 will be appropriated to the Department of
Research and Development to provide a grant to Boys and Girls Club of the Big Island to assist
with operating expenses.
Attached is a resolution authorizing the transfer of$7,500 from the Clerk-Council Services—
Contingency Relief account to the following account and project:
